- MAKING A CLEAN BOOT DISK
- ------------------------
- If you encounter problems running Cargo Bay there may be a conflict
- between it and a program resident in memory. Here's a way to avoid
- the conflict.
-
- Place a blank, unformatted diskette into drive A of your computer.
- Then type
-
- FORMAT A:/S/U
-
- and press enter. When the computer is finished formatting the disk
- and copying the system files to it, press the RESET button on your
- computer or the ALT-CTRL-DEL keys at the same time. After your
- computer has rebooted, go to the Cargo Bay directory and play the
- game. If it runs, there is a conflict between a resident program
- loaded by your AUTOEXEC.BAT or CONFIG.SYS file. Whenever you want
- to play Cargo Bay, simply reboot your computer with the boot disk
- you have created.

- =========================< THE STORY >=========================
-
- Altair-217 is an experiment in peace. Five warring planets have
- decided to work out their differences by sending diplomats and
- colonists to coexist at this space station. The Taurien
- Coalition, however, has other plans. This criminal group with
- members from the five races has vowed to keep the peace
- initiative from succeeding. They have planted iradium explosive
- devices in the colonists' cargo bays throughout the station.
- If detonated, the races will blame each other, and all hopes for
- peace will vanish.
-
- You play Lt. Marston, Head of Security for Altair-217. You have
- just received a communique. HQ Sector Command has directed you
- to clear the station of all iradium devices before they can
- be detonated. To fail would mean the destruction of the station,
- and the end of the peace.

- The Game Screen:
- 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
- On the left side of the game screen is the play field. This is
- where the action takes place in Cargo Bay. The shimmering blue
- squares are beam pads. Your goal is to push all of the crates
- onto these pads before the timer runs out. At the top-right of
- the screen is the "Status" section. This tells you the current
- state of the game. There are four displays, labeled "SCORE,"
- "TIME," "BAY" and "LEVEL."
-
- SCORE - Current total score for the game.
- TIME - Time left until detonation of the iradium charges.
- BAY - The current bay you are playing.
- LEVEL - The current level.
-
- Directly below the "Status" display is the "Controls" board. It
- has four labels that read "EXIT", "HELP", "OPTIONS" and "UNDO".
- Next to each label is a button with the keyboard equivalent
- printed on it.
-
- EXIT [ESC] - Exit the current bay.
- HELP [F1] - Display the "Help" screens.
- OPTIONS [O] - Display the "Options" dialog box.
- UNDO [U] - Undo to the position prior to the last push.
-
- Below these controls are four arrows representing Grav-Sled
- movement keys. To activate any of these, click on the button
- with your mouse, or press the associated keyboard equivalent.
-
- Scoring:
- 10 points for each crate pushed onto a beampad.
- 100 points for each bay solved.
- 500 points for each level solved.

- Sound Overrides:
- 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
- Most of the time, Cargo Bay will correctly determine whether you
- have a sound card, and if so, what its settings are. However,
- there may be a time when this doesn't work perfectly for your
- system. If you play Cargo Bay and you don't hear any sound
- effects or music, you should first make certain that the volume
- is turned up on your speakers, that they are properly connected,
- that the volume is turned up on the "Options" dialog box, and
- that the "Sound FX" and "Music" buttons read ON. If not, you may
- need to enter command line overrides to manually set your sound
- card's parameters.
-
- There are three options that you may provide on the command line.
- These are PORT, IRQ, and DMA. Refer to your sound card's
- documentation to see what these values should be. You do not have
- to enter each value, only the one that isn't being correctly
- detected. However, if you aren't sure which one that is, enter
- all three just to be safe. To enter them, simply type them after
- the word CARGO when you start the game, like this:
-
- CARGO DMA:1 PORT:220 IRQ:7
-
- These values are just examples. You must use the correct values
- for your card, as specified by the manufacturer. Either capital
- or lower case letters is acceptable. If you make a mistake
- entering the values, Cargo Bay will exit with a message
- giving you the proper format.
